Output 3fafd4823d99fa7c5a2c342b8eb853e9fdda57b08cfb64b2a1e87b7b10026020:2

value
173667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 889cdcb1bdb2cbe745584cc787bb6bb35d0ba82b OP_EQUAL
address
3E9MjbqxCg5FrNFJZ2xgExjSBEKgeJfYb6
transaction
3fafd4823d99fa7c5a2c342b8eb853e9fdda57b08cfb64b2a1e87b7b10026020
confirmations
271793
spent
true